Dopo che hai verificato di avere spazio a sufficienza nella flash per il trasferimento del nuovo sistema operativo (IOS) e aver configurato lo switch con i parametri di rete, puoi procedere all'aggiornamento del firmware. Verifichiamo ora come eseguire la procedura di firmware update per la sola versione binaria del file (.bin)
Trasferimento del nuovo IOS (file .bin)
Se lo spazio lo consente possiamo procedere a copiare nella flash il nuovo sistema operativo (IOS) in formato binario, senza cancellare il precedente in modo da tenerlo di riserva nel caso andasse male qualche cosa:
Switch# copy tftp://192.168.0.1/c2960-lanbasek9-mz.122-52.SE.bin flash:
Accessing tftp://192.168.0.1/c2960-lanbasek9-mz.122-52.SE.bin...
Loading c2960-lanbasek9-mz.122-52.SE.bin from 192.168.0.1: !!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!
[OK - 8471143 bytes]
8471143 bytes copied in 116.837 secs (72504 bytes/sec)
|
Potrebbe accadere che la copia non vada a buon fine perchè non abbiamo spazio a sufficienza
Accessing tftp://192.168.0.1/c2960-lanbasek9-mz.122-52.SE.bin...
Loading c2960-lanbasek9-mz.122-52.SE.bin from 192.168.0.1 (via Vlan1): !!!!!!!!!!!!!!!!!!!!OO!OOO!O!OOOO!OOOOOOOOOO... [timed out]
%Error reading tftp://192.168.0.1/c2960-lanbasek9-mz.122-52.SE.bin (Timed out) |
Se ciò non fosse possibile si dovrà procedere con la rimozione del precedente sistema operativo che può essere eseguita in due maniere
- automatica (gestita dallo switch)
- manuale
Nel primo caso useremo il comando erease per sovrascrivere file esistenti. In questa maniera lo switch stesso si occuperà di liberare lo spazio necessario. Dovremo solo indicargli che cosa sovrascrivere.
Switch# copy /erase tftp://192.168.0.1/c2960-lanbasek9-mz.122-52.SE.bin flash:
Destination filename [c2960-lanbasek9-mz.122-44.SE.bin]?
Do you want to over write? [confirm]
Accessing tftp://192.168.0.1/c2960-lanbasek9-mz.122-52.SE.bin...
Loading c2960-lanbasek9-mz.122-52.SE.bin from 192.168.0.1 (via Vlan1): !!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!
[OK - 8471143 bytes]
8471143 bytes copied in 116.837 secs (72504 bytes/sec) |
Altrimenti possiamo procedere manualmente alla rimozione dei file in eccesso con il comando delete per avere la flash libera o alla sua completa riformattazione con il comando format avendo l'accortezza che quest'ultima operazione è delicata e se per caso si perdesse la corrente lo switch si troverebbe senza alcun sistema operativo e si sarebbe costretti a usare xmodem con notevole dipsersione di tempo.
Switch# delete flash:c2960-lanbasek9-mz.122-53.SE.bin
Delete filename [c2960-lanbasek9-mz.122-53.SE.bin]?
Delete flash:c2960-lanbasek9-mz.122-53.SE.bin? [confirm] |
Altri articoli correlati